Mini dental implants vs traditional implants is a topic that has gained substantial attention in the realm of dentistry. Understanding their variations can empower patients to make informed selections about their oral check it out health.

Traditional dental implants have been a regular therapy for missing teeth for decades. They involve a surgical process the place a titanium publish is inserted into the jawbone to function a root for a replacement tooth. This methodology often provides wonderful stability and durability. The course of usually requires substantial therapeutic time and an enough amount of bone density to help the implant.

Mini dental implants, then again, are smaller in diameter than traditional implants. They are designed for situations where there isn't sufficient bone to help a conventional implant. This smaller dimension permits for a much less invasive procedure, which can be a vital benefit for many patients who may be hesitant about undergoing surgery.


The set up of traditional implants can contain multiple visits to the dentist, usually spanning a number of months. Once the titanium publish is implanted, it usually requires time to fuse with the bone, a course of known as osseointegration. This implies that sufferers could additionally be left with no tooth for weeks or months during recovery.

In contrast, mini dental implants can usually be positioned in a single go to. They usually do not require bone grafting, making them suitable for people with restricted bone structure. This efficiency not only saves time however also can alleviate some anxiousness associated with extended therapy.


While each choices serve the purpose of replacing missing teeth, they range by means of their applications. Mini dental implants are often really helpful for sufferers who require denture stabilization. They can successfully anchor dentures in place, giving sufferers extra confidence in their consuming and speaking abilities.

Traditional implants provide larger help for particular person crowns and bridges. For patients looking for long-term options, they might be a greater choice as a end result of their sturdiness and longevity. However, both varieties are valuable relying on the specific needs and conditions of the affected person.


The cost also can differ considerably between the 2 forms of implants. Generally, traditional implants are costlier as a result of further complexity of the process, along with the requisite healing and follow-up visits. Mini dental implants normally represent a more economical selection for some patients, making dental restoration accessible to a broader demographic.


Another issue to think about is the potential for complications. Traditional implants, with their invasive nature, can result in points like infection or implant failure - Implant Dental Grand Rapids MI. Mini implants, being less invasive, may have a decrease risk on this regard, though they don't appear to be entirely free from problems


It's important for patients to consult with their dental professionals to understand the best suited choice for their unique situation. Factors similar to bone density, finances, and private preference can play a crucial position on this decision-making course of. In many instances, dentists can present insights that help information sufferers toward probably the most appropriate alternative.

  • Mini dental implants typically require much less invasive procedures, minimizing affected person discomfort and lowering recovery times in comparison with traditional implants.

  • The smaller dimension of mini dental implants permits for placement in areas with restricted bone density, making them a viable possibility for patients who might not qualify for conventional implants.

  • Cost-effective options are sometimes related to mini implants, typically resulting in decrease total therapy bills than these linked with conventional implants.

  • Traditional implants tend to supply extra stability and help, significantly for larger restorations, making them more suitable for full-arch replacements.

  • Mini implants can often be placed in a single go to, whereas traditional implants might contain multiple appointments for planning, placement, and therapeutic phases.

  • A higher success rate has been recorded for traditional implants over the long term, particularly in cases requiring larger chew pressure tolerance.

  • Mini dental implants offer a less complicated elimination course of, making them an possibility for sufferers who may need adjustments or replacements sooner or later.

  • The aesthetic outcomes could differ, with some patients preferring the natural look provided by conventional implants when contemplating gum contour and materials options.

  • Both forms of implants require diligent oral hygiene practices, but mini implants may current unique maintenance challenges as a result of their smaller dimension and design.

  • Overall, the choice between mini and traditional dental implants hinges on particular person useful reference patient wants, bone quality, and finances issues.
